Dec. 5th, 2003 09:51 pmA newborn hat that I made today using the following pattern with some left over yarn.
SIZE: Fits newborn babies to 3 months.
MATERIALS: Lion Brand Jamie, or sport-weight yarn-less than one 1.75 oz. skein for one hat. Crochet hook size F, OR SIZE NEEDED TO OBTAIN GAUGE·
GAUGE: 4 half double crochet=1"; 2 rows=1".
RUFFLED HAT: Loosely chain 25.
Row 1: Starting in third chain from hook, work 1 half double crochet in each chain across. Chain 2, turn.
Row 2: Skip first half double crochet, work 1 half double crochet in each half double crochet across. Chain 2, turn.
Row 3: Work 1 half double crochet in first half double crochet, 2 half double crochet in each half double crochet across.
Row 4: Skip first half double crochet, work 1 half double crochet in each half double crochet across. Chain 3, turn. Repeat Row 4 until a total of 14 rows have been worked. Ch2, turn.
Ruffle: Work 3 half double crochet in each stitch across. Fasten off.
Finishing: With yarn needle and double yarn, draw a gathering thread through each stitch along foundation chain edge. Draw up to gather and tie securely. Sew back seam edges.
Pompon: Hole thumb and forefinger about 2" apart, wrap yarn around them 100 times. Tie center of the loops with a separate strand of yarn. Cut both ends of loop and trim. Sew securely to top of hat. Fold back last two rows for ruffle.
Plain Hat: Work as for Ruffled Hat for a total of 12 rows. Fasten off and finish as for Ruffled Hat.
